Death toll continues to rise as US military launches new offensive in Iraq
Thursday, January 10, 2008 :Six American soldiers were killed in Iraq on Wednesday during the US military’s New Year offensive against anti-occupation insurgents in the province of Diyala, north of Baghdad. The operation, codenamed Iron Harvest, is the fourth major assault in the area during the past six months and underscores the entrenched nature of the guerilla war against the US occupation and the US-backed Iraqi government.
